One of three cubs I watched climb this cherry tree in Cades Cove — mama kept a close eye from below while her trio worke...
08/15/2026

One of three cubs I watched climb this cherry tree in Cades Cove — mama kept a close eye from below while her trio worked their way up for the ripest fruit. Cherry season means dinner is served, black bear style. 🐻🍒

When art meets purpose, something beautiful happens — twice.

I’m so excited to share that my photograph “Aerial Architect” — a bald eagle captured mid-build, bringing in nesting material with that quiet, focused determination only eagles seem to pull off — was donated to the American Society of Safety Professionals (ASSP) Central Florida Chapter and it raised more than $1,200 for workplace safety scholarships!

The winning ticket was drawn at the recent Associated Builders and Contractors (ABC) of Central Florida Safety Champions Conference, and the winner, John Lucarelli, has chosen to display “Aerial Architect” at Alpha-Omega Training and Compliance, Inc. I love knowing that image has found a home in a workplace — a daily reminder of the focus, precision, and commitment that the best safety professionals bring to their work every single day.
